Grocery Outlet, the Emeryville-based discount grocer, has announced plans to shutter 36 underperforming stores as part of a strategic optimization plan following a substantial quarterly loss. While the specific locations remain undisclosed, the company continues to invest in the Bay Area with plans to open two new stores.

On the sports front, the Golden State Warriors secured a thrilling overtime victory against the Houston Rockets, thanks to De'Anthony Melton's decisive play and Brandon Podziemski's standout performance. Despite Stephen Curry's continued absence, the Warriors maintain their momentum as they prepare to face Oklahoma City next.

For surf enthusiasts, the Ocean Beach forecast promises fair conditions with waves peaking at five to seven feet, while the weekend offers sunny weather with highs reaching the low seventies. Nationally, the stock market shows signs of recovery amidst economic uncertainties, and a new study highlights the underestimated threat of rising sea levels due to climate change.
